Africa: Recent Informal Talks on Western Sahara

November 11, 2010 /EINPresswire.com/ --

Philip J. Crowley
Assistant Secretary, Bureau of Public Affairs
Washington, DC
November 10, 2010


We commend the parties for engaging in a third round of informal talks this week hosted in New York by the U.N. Secretary General’s Personal Envoy for Western Sahara Christopher Ross. We also welcome the progress the parties made on confidence-building measures. They agreed to resume family visits by air without delay on the basis of strict application of the agreed Plan of Action of 2004 and to accelerate the inauguration of family visits by road. The parties also agreed to meet again in December and subsequently early next year. We urge the parties to engage seriously with each other and with Special Envoy Ross to work toward a peaceful, sustainable and mutually-agreed solution to the Western Sahara conflict.
